The EFR32BG24A010F1024IM40-BR is a low power wireless System-on-Chip (SoC) designed for Bluetooth Low Energy and Bluetooth mesh applications. It features a 32-bit ARM Cortex-M33 core operating at up to 78 MHz, with 1024 kB of flash memory and 128 kB of RAM, providing ample resources for various applications. The device supports a maximum transmit power of 10 dBm and offers high sensitivity levels, with -105.7 dBm at 125 kbps GFSK. This SoC is optimized for energy efficiency, with low active and sleep currents, making it suitable for battery-operated devices. It includes an AI/ML hardware accelerator for enhanced processing capabilities in applications such as predictive maintenance and smart home devices. The EFR32BG24A010F1024IM40-BR also incorporates security features like Secure Vault, hardware cryptographic acceleration, and a true random number generator, ensuring robust protection against cyber threats. The device operates within a voltage range of 1.71 V to 3.8 V and is rated for a wide temperature range of -40 ¬8C to 125 ¬8C. It is packaged in a compact 40-pin QFN format, making it suitable for space-constrained designs. Target applications include smart home devices, portable medical equipment, and various IoT solutions.
